When I tried to clone the above repos on Mac OS X, I got the following
errors. The default disk on Mac OS X is not case sensitive. How to
deal with such a problem? Thanks.

warning: the following paths have collided (e.g. case-sensitive paths
on a case-insensitive filesystem) and only one from the same
colliding group is in the working tree:

  'man2/_Exit.2'
  'man2/_exit.2'
  'man3/NAN.3'
  'man3/nan.3'

warning: the following paths have collided (e.g. case-sensitive paths
on a case-insensitive filesystem) and only one from the same
colliding group is in the working tree:

  'man-pages-posix-2003/man3p/_Exit.3p'
  'man-pages-posix-2003/man3p/_exit.3p'
